Six months of breastfeeding tied to decrease odds of developmental delays

Unique or longer period of breastfeeding (a minimum of six months) is related to decreased odds of developmental delays, in line with a examine printed on-line March 24 in JAMA Community Open.

Inbal Goldshtein, Ph.D., from the KI Analysis Institute in Kfar Malal, Israel, and colleagues estimated the unbiased affiliation between breastfeeding and attainment of developmental milestones or neurodevelopmental circumstances. The evaluation included information from 570,532 youngsters recognized via a nationwide community for routine little one improvement surveillance.

The researchers discovered that 52.1% of youngsters had been breastfed for a minimum of six months. Breastfeeding for a minimum of six months was related to fewer delays achieve language and social or motor developmental milestones versus lower than six months of breastfeeding (adjusted odds ratios, 0.73 for unique breastfeeding and 0.86 for nonexclusive breastfeeding). Comparable findings had been seen amongst 37,704 sibling pairs, with youngsters who had been breastfed for a minimum of six months exhibiting decrease probability of milestone attainment delays (odds ratio, 0.91) or being recognized with neurodevelopmental circumstances (odds ratio, 0.73) versus their sibling with lower than six months of breastfeeding or no breastfeeding.

“In this cohort study, breastfeeding persistence was associated with lower incidence of developmental delays,” the authors write. “These findings may guide parents, caregivers, and public health initiatives in promoting optimal child development.”
